Are wechat payment and tenpay the same thing?
Wechat payment and Tenpay are not the same thing, and the differences are as follows:

1, Tenpay is a platform, and WeChat payment is a product.

Tenpay is a third-party payment platform, and WeChat payment including QQ wallet are products on this payment platform. Tenpay supports the basic payment ability and technical support of WeChat payment.

2. Tenpay is the leader and WeChat payment is the staff.

The structure of WeChat payment belongs to Tenpay, that is to say, WeChat payment is just a new expression of Tenpay product model, and its core and license correspond to Tenpay. For banks, Tenpay is the payment institution that has signed a contract with them, so the prompt message of the bank card is that Tenpay function has been opened.

3. Tenpay obtained the third-party payment license in May, 20 1 1. At present, WeChat has not applied for a third-party license separately.

In essence, WeChat is the front-end channel, the back-end business takes Tenpay, and the payment transfer is completed by Tenpay. In other words, WeChat completes business scenarios, and background processing such as payment transfer system should be Tenpay.

I. Alipay

1, background overview

Alipay (www.alipay.com) was founded by Alibaba, the world's leading B2B website, and launched on Taobao in June 2003. Alipay is committed to providing various safe, convenient and personalized online payment solutions for e-commerce in China. At present, in addition to Taobao and Alibaba, there are more than 200,000 merchants who support the use of Alipay.

Alipay has won the recognition of banks and other partners by virtue of its advanced technology, risk management and control in the field of electronic payment. At present, it has established strategic cooperation with major domestic commercial banks, China Post, VISA International and other institutions, and has become a trusted partner of financial institutions in the field of online payment. Alipay is a pioneering work in the development of Internet and a milestone in the development of e-commerce.

Alipay's concept of building trust, simplifying complexity and perfecting credit system through technological innovation has won the hearts of the people. In just three years, users have covered the whole C2C, B2C and B2B fields. As of September 1 day, 2008, the number of users using Alipay has exceeded 1 billion, the daily transaction volume of Alipay exceeds 450 million yuan, and the daily transaction volume exceeds 2 million.

At present, in addition to Taobao and Alibaba, there are more than 330,000 merchants who support the use of Alipay trading services; Covering virtual games, digital communication, commercial services, air tickets and other industries. While enjoying Alipay services, these businesses have a very potential consumer market.

5. Recharge channels

Alipay supports eight recharge channels: account balance, online banking, offline branch payment, credit card payment, mobile phone payment, consumer card recharge, international card payment and voice payment.

Second, Tenpay (Tenpay)

1, background overview

Tenpay (www.tenpay.com) is a professional online payment platform officially launched by Tencent in September 2005, which is dedicated to providing safe, convenient and professional online payment services for Internet users and enterprises.

Tenpay has built a brand-new comprehensive payment platform, covering B2B, B2C and C2C fields, providing excellent online payment and clearing services. For individual users, Tenpay provides rich functions including online recharge, cash withdrawal, payment and transaction management. For enterprise users, Tenpay provides safe and reliable payment and clearing services and distinctive QQ marketing resources support.

Tenpay has successively won the Top Ten Award of Electronic Payment Platform in 2006, the Best Convenient Payment Award in 2006, the Platform Award with the Most Growth Potential of Electronic Payment in China in 2006 and the Award of the Most Competitive Electronic Payment Enterprise in 2007. In 2007, Tenpay took the lead in obtaining financial support from the National E-commerce Special Fund.

Third, ChinaPay.

1, background overview

UnionPay Electronic Payment Service Co., Ltd. (www.chinapay.com/) is a professional bank card service company controlled by China UnionPay. It has a national unified payment platform, mainly engaged in online payment and value-added services of bank cards based on the Internet, B2B account payment, telephone payment, online inter-bank transfer, online fund transaction, corporate public and private fund payment, self-service terminal payment and other emerging channels. It is a network army under China UnionPay.

3, the operation process

(1), consumers browse the merchant's website, buy goods, put them in the shopping cart and enter the cashier;

(2) the online merchant generates a payment bill according to the contents of the shopping cart, and calls the merchant interface plug-in of the ChinaPay payment gateway to digitally sign the payment bill;

(3) The online merchant submits the payment slip and the merchant's digital signature on the payment slip to the consumer for confirmation;

(4) Once the consumer confirms the payment, the payment slip and the merchant's digital signature on the payment slip will be automatically forwarded to ChinaPay payment gateway; ?

(5) the payment gateway verifies the identity and data consistency of the merchant who pays the bill, generates a payment page to show to the consumer, and establishes SSL connection between the consumer browser and the payment gateway;

(6) The consumer fills in the card number, password and expiration date of the bank card (applicable to credit cards), encrypts the payment information through the payment page, and submits it to the payment gateway;

(7) After verifying the transaction data, the payment gateway assembles the consumer transaction according to the requirements of the bank card transaction center, and encrypts it through the hardware encryption machine and submits it to the bank card network center;

(8) the bank card exchange center routes the transaction request to the consumer's card-issuing bank according to the payment bank card information, and the banking system returns the transaction result to the bank card exchange center after processing the transaction; ?

(9) The bank card transaction center sends the payment result back to ChinaPay payment gateway;

(10), the payment gateway verifies the transaction response, digitally signs it, sends it to the merchant, and displays the payment result to the consumer;

(1 1). The merchant receives the transaction response message and carries out subsequent processing according to the transaction status code.
